#4dce7e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4dce7e is composed of 30.2% red, 80.8% green and 49.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.8%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 142.8 degrees, a saturation of 56.8% and a lightness of 55.5%. #4dce7e color hex could be obtained by blending #9afffc with #009d00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#4dce7e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4dce7e has RGB values of R:77, G:206, B:126 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0, Y:0.39,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 5099134.

Shades and Tints of #4dce7e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020704 is the darkest color, while #f6fd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4dce7e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8a918d is the less saturated color, while #21fa74 is the most saturated one.
